"Good information on the mechanics of song presentation" according to Student. This book is about arrangement from a mixing or mastering perspective rather that from a composing perspective. It is more about arranging sections of a song rather than arranging notes. Good information for a new band.. "Workflow for the small studio" according to rob_2. About the Author Amos Clarke has been working as a recording and mix engineer, songwriter and producer for well over 10 years. He has worked extensively in live sound and as a bass player and vocalist in working bands that have gigged around the world. Amos currently runs sHOWpONY, a boutique recording and production studio in Auckland, New Zealand.
